Safety features A 3-wheel scooter has a lower turning radius than a four-wheel model and is perfect for those searching for a mobility scooter that can move through tight spaces. Additionally, they are usually smaller and less expensive than their four-wheeled counterparts. Some 3-wheel mobility scooters can carry up to 400 pounds and travel over 10 miles per charge. These scooters typically offer several additional safety features, such as headlights and brake lights that come on when the scooter is powered up and adjustable armrests as well as a height for the seat. Some scooters have baskets to store belongings and a rear suspension that absorbs bumps. Other features include an LED light, a horn and a battery strength indicator. These scooters are ideal for both outdoor and indoor use and can easily be dismantled to fit in the trunk of an automobile. In addition to the essential safety features 3-wheel mobility scooters usually come with a comfortable, captain's-style adjustable seat as well as armrests that are cushioned. They also come with large rear and front storage baskets, and a charging port that is located below the control panel. Certain models also come with a large adjustable steering column that makes it easier to navigate. The ground clearance is a second important aspect to take into consideration when choosing a three-wheeled mobility scooter. This is especially crucial for those living in areas with hills. The higher the clearance from the ground is, the better the scooter will be able to deal with uneven surfaces and steep inclines or declines. Like any other item of equipment, it's important to maintain a 3-wheeled mobility scooter regularly in order to ensure that it is operating effectively. When not in use, it's important to keep your scooter clean and covered with a waterproof cover. This will stop water from entering the motor's electric circuit and cause damage. Maintaining your scooter will help prevent costly repairs and prolong the life of your scooter. Regular cleaning will also help reduce dust and dirt buildup, which can lead to corrosion or other issues. It is also important to inspect your tires frequently to ensure that they're correctly inflated.
